Как функционирует интернет: от требования до скачивания страниц
Каждый день миллионы людей открывают браузеры и получают доступ к информации. Процесс загрузки веб-страницы выглядит быстрым, но за этим скрывается последовательность технологических процедур. Она охватывает трансформацию адреса vulkan casino, установление связи с отдалённым компьютером, отправку данных и отображение контента. Понимание этих шагов содействует постичь, как организована глобальная сеть.
Что совершается в момент, когда вводится адрес сайта
Пользователь набирает адрес в строку браузера и нажимает клавишу ввода. Браузер приступает обработку обращения с разбора введённой строки. Приложение контролирует, является ли текст правильным адресом или поисковым запросом. Если строка имеет точки и подходит шаблону веб-адреса, браузер трактует её как URL.
После определения категории обращения браузер разбирает адрес на элементарные части. Адрес содержит протокол передачи данных, доменное имя и маршрут к странице. Протокол указывает метод обмена данными. Доменное имя представляет символьное обозначение ресурса в сети.
Браузер сверяет личную память на существование кэшированных сведений о ресурсе. Кэш может включать копии файлов, что ускоряет загрузку. Если сведения релевантна, браузер применяет сохранённые данные. Вулкан казино зависит от конфигурации кэширования и периода финального взаимодействия к ресурсу.
Как система доменных имён содействует обнаружить необходимый сервер
Компьютеры в сети передают данными, задействуя цифровые адреса. Человеку непросто запоминать ряды цифр, поэтому была сформирована система доменных имён. Эта система преобразует буквенные наименования в цифровые идентификаторы, доступные сетевым оборудованию.
Когда браузер извлекает доменное имя, он обращается к специальным серверам DNS. Запрос идёт через несколько этапов. Корневые серверы перенаправляют обращение к серверам зон верхнего уровня. Те передают запрос к авторитетным серверам специфического домена.
Авторитетный сервер предоставляет численный адрес запрашиваемого ресурса. Браузер кэширует данные в местном кэше. При последующем обращении браузер задействует сохранённые данные, что сокращает длительность процесса. казино Вулкан производится за доли секунды, но содержит массу промежуточных шагов между различными серверами.
Связь между адресом сайта и численным адресом устройства
Доменное имя выступает комфортным наименованием для юзеров. Числовой адрес являет индивидуальный код устройства в сети. Система DNS создаёт соответствие между текстовым именем и числовым значением. Один домен может соответствовать нескольким адресам, если ресурс размещён на отличающихся серверах. Такая архитектура гарантирует стабильность деятельности сетевых служб.
Формирование связи: как устройства передают сигналами
После получения числового адреса браузер начинает связь с сервером. Устройства делятся выделенными сигналами для формирования канала связи. Клиент передаёт требование на соединение. Сервер извлекает требование и отправляет подтверждение готовности к взаимодействию информацией.
Клиент принимает уведомление и посылает конечный команду. Этот трёхэтапный обмен именуется рукопожатием. Алгоритм обеспечивает готовность обеих сторон к пересылке информации. После завершения формируется устойчивый путь для обмена сведениями.
Для защищённых соединений осуществляются добавочные шаги. Устройства согласовывают характеристики шифрования и передают ключами. Сервер предоставляет цифровой сертификат. Вулкан казино контролирует сертификат и устанавливает закодированный канал, охраняющий информацию от кражи.
Отправка данных: как информация движется от сервера к юзеру
После формирования соединения запускается передача информации. Браузер отправляет HTTP-запрос, несущий информацию о запрашиваемом ресурсе. Обращение охватывает метод обращения, адрес к файлу и добавочные настройки. Сервер обрабатывает обращение и формирует реакцию.
Информация отправляются небольшими фрагментами, называемыми пакетами. Каждый пакет включает фрагмент сведений и вспомогательные данные для маршрутизации. Пакеты проходят через ряд посреднических узлов сети. Маршрутизаторы отправляют пакеты к клиенту, выбирая оптимальные маршруты.
Адресат объединяет пакеты в правильном последовательности и сверяет целостность данных. Если пакеты потеряны или искажены, инициируется вторичная отправка. казино Вулкан гарантирует устойчивую доставку данных. Протоколы пересылки управляют темп пересылки, подстраиваясь к транспортной возможности пути связи.
Почему защищенное подключение имеет значение
Кодирование защищает сведения от несанкционированного вторжения. Атакующие не могут прочитать зашифрованную данные при захвате. Защищённое подключение Вулкан верифицирует подлинность сервера. Юзеры могут надёжно отправлять личные сведения и финансовую сведения.
Сервер и его ответ: как генерируется наполнение страницы
Сервер извлекает обращение от браузера и приступает обработку. Программное обеспечение изучает маршрут к искомому ресурсу. Если требуется неизменный файл, сервер получает его из файловой системы. Фиксированные файлы включают картинки, таблицы стилей и подготовленные документы.
Для динамических страниц сервер исполняет программный код. Код апеллирует к хранилищам сведений для приёма релевантной сведений. Сервер компонует информацию из различных ресурсов и формирует HTML-документ. Процесс создания зависит от запутанности запроса и количества сведений.
После генерации наполнения сервер формирует HTTP-ответ. Ответ содержит код положения, заголовки и основу сообщения. Заголовки хранят метаданные о передаваемом наполнении. Вулкан отправляет созданный ответ обратно клиенту по установленному соединению.
Из чего состоит веб-страница
Веб-страница составляет собой совокупность различных файлов и компонентов. Базу образует HTML-документ, устанавливающий организацию и содержание. HTML использует теги для форматирования текста, заголовков и иных элементов. Документ содержит отсылки на дополнительные элементы.
Таблицы стилей CSS управляют за зрительное дизайн страницы. Стили устанавливают цвета, шрифты, габариты и расположение элементов. Один файл стилей может использоваться к массе страниц. JavaScript привносит интерактивность и активное функционирование. Скрипты обрабатывают манипуляции клиента и трансформируют содержимое без рефреша.
Изображения, видео и аудиофайлы обогащают текстовое наполнение. Шрифты могут скачиваться независимо для необходимого представления текста. Вулкан казино извлекает все необходимые элементы после получения основного HTML-документа, создавая завершённую представление страницы.
Как браузер обрабатывает и отображает контент
Браузер принимает HTML-документ и приступает грамматический анализ. Программа последовательно анализирует код и формирует древовидную структуру частей. Эта организация именуется элементной схемой документа. Каждый тег становится элементом дерева, ассоциированным с родительскими и дочерними узлами.
Одновременно браузер обрабатывает таблицы стилей. Приложение задействует инструкции оформления к подходящим элементам. Рассчитываются величины, позиции и зрительные свойства каждого элемента. Браузер формирует дерево рендеринга, соединяющее организацию и дизайн.
На очередном этапе происходит компоновка частей. Браузер вычисляет конкретные позиции и величины каждого блока. После окончания расчётов стартует рендеринг. казино Вулкан отображает точки на экран, генерируя зримое картинку. При загрузке дополнительных компонентов браузер обновляет отображение.
Функция организации страницы, стилизации и интерактивных частей
HTML устанавливает логическую организацию содержимого и структуру компонентов. CSS создаёт графическую эстетичность и улучшает усвоение сведений. JavaScript гарантирует отклик на манипуляции юзера. Комбинация трёх инструментов генерирует работоспособные веб-интерфейсы. Разделение организации казино Вулкан, дизайна и функционирования ускоряет построение порталов.
Почему скорость загрузки страниц может различаться
Темп загрузки зависит от множества обстоятельств. Пропускная ёмкость интернет-соединения воздействует на время отправки информации. Слабое подключение удлиняет длительность скачивания файлов. Удалённость между клиентом и сервером равным образом представляет важность. Чем удалённее находится сервер, тем дольше времени нужно для прохождения импульса.
Размер и количество ресурсов на странице воздействуют на суммарное длительность подгрузки. Страницы с обилием изображений и скриптов загружаются продолжительнее. Улучшение файлов сокращает массив отправляемых информации. Сжатие графики и упрощение кода убыстряют подгрузку.
Мощность сервера определяет темп обработки запросов. Занятый сервер неторопливее генерирует реакции. Вулкан может переживать задержки при высокой загрузке. Качество маршрутизации влияет на длительность передачи пакетов.
Размещение данных и разделение загрузки: как повышается подключение к сайтам
Для повышения доступа применяются системы кэширования. Переходные серверы записывают реплики регулярно востребованных элементов. Когда юзер апеллирует к ресурсу, запрос обрабатывается ближайшим кэширующим сервером. Это сокращает расстояние отправки информации и понижает активность.
Сети распространения контента располагают реплики компонентов на серверах по планетарному миру. Юзеры получают сведения от географически ближнего сервера. Такая архитектура минимизирует замедления и повышает скорость скачивания. Размещение контента продуктивно для фиксированных файлов: графики, стилей и скриптов.
Балансировщики нагрузки разносят требования между множественными серверами. Если один сервер занят, запросы направляются к слабее занятым узлам. Вулкан гарантирует стабильную работу при большом потоке. Резервирование увеличивает стабильность: при поломке одного сервера запросы перенаправляются к активным серверам.
Как действия пользователя влияют на загрузку страницы
Действия юзера прямо воздействуют на ход загрузки. Нажатие по ссылке инициирует свежий требование к серверу. Браузер возобновляет последовательность: конвертацию адреса, установление связи и приём данных. Внесение форм и пересылка сведений создают добавочные запросы.
Пролистывание страницы может активировать подгрузку добавочных частей. Механизм отсроченной загрузки загружает изображения по степени необходимости. Такой способ повышает начальную подгрузку и сохраняет поток. Интерактивные части реагируют на передвижения указателя, исполняя скрипты и изменяя контент.
Конфигурация браузера сказываются на функционирование при скачивании. Деактивация JavaScript останавливает выполнение скриптов. Блокировщики рекламы блокируют скачивание специфических ресурсов. Вулкан казино может записывать настройки пользователя, воздействующие на вывод контента и скорость деятельности портала.